pulling a steering column???

I want to pull a steering column that has the adjustable heighth on it for my 88 f-250... Is that a hard job? Can I do it by myself? Has anyone done it before? how long does it take? what all do you have to do???? what tools will i need??? Oh and most importantly what columns are compatable with my truck? The place I'm going has most all F150's. If they are from the 87-91 era does it matter whether i pull it from a F-150, F-250, or F-350???

not sure if this answers, but i used a column from a 150 to put into my 87 250. was one model year off, i dont remember which way. it was pretty easy, there are 5 or 6 bolts at inside of cabin that need to be loosened, also one bolt at steering box to disconnect. mine had adjustable length between steering box and firewall that was easy to adapt. if you can do it, get whole column from steering box to steering wheel, not just one half or another. don't have to mess with connection just inside fire wall that separates in cabin half from half inside engine compartment. took me about 2 hours working pretty slow.

forgot to add, its almost a one person job, except it helps to have someone to help to set the correct length on the adjustable length cylincer inside the engine compartment. i connect the column at steering box, my son pulled in or out on the column untill the length was correct, then i attached the bolts inside the cab at the firewall.
